Where this album fits

Career context
Released in 1972, 'The Good Things in Life' came during Tony Bennett's career resurgence following his commercial decline in the late 1960s. This album marked a return to traditional pop and jazz standards, showcasing Bennett's rich vocal style at a time when he was re-establishing his presence in the music industry.
